The composition of fatty acids and cholesterol content in the milk of small ruminants
2002
Dankow, R. | Cais-Sokolinska, D. | Pikul, J. (Poznan Agricultural University (Poland). Dept. of Dairy Technology)
The profile of individual fatty acids and cholesterol were specified in the milk of the ewes from the synthetic milk line and White-breed graded goats and hybrid goats of the White graded breed and the Boer breed. On the basis of the obtained results it was found that the percentage of saturated fatty acids in the milk of hybrid goats is much lower than in the milk of White-breed graded goats and ewe milk. Simultaneously, the percentage of unsaturated fatty acids remains at a higher level in goat milk rather than ewe milk. It was found that in ewe milk the amount of contained cholesterol is twice as big as in goat milk
